Book Overview

French Civilization: From Its Origins To The Close Of The Middle Ages (1921) is a comprehensive book written by Albert Leon Guerard, which explores the history of French civilization from its earliest beginnings to the end of the Middle Ages. The book covers a wide range of topics, including the origins of the French people, the development of the French language, the rise and fall of the Roman Empire in France, the impact of Christianity on French society, the emergence of feudalism, the Crusades, the Hundred Years' War, and the Black Death.Guerard's writing style is engaging and informative, making the book accessible to both scholars and general readers. He draws on a wide range of historical sources, including contemporary accounts, literature, and art, to provide a vivid picture of French civilization during this period. The book also contains numerous illustrations, maps, and diagrams to help readers visualize the historical events and cultural developments discussed in the text.Overall, French Civilization: From Its Origins To The Close Of The Middle Ages is a valuable resource for anyone interested in the history of France and its cultural heritage.
